fre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

畢業(yè)設(shè)計(jì)-基于單片機(jī)的8路輸入模擬信號(hào)數(shù)值顯示器設(shè)計(jì)-展示頁(yè)

2025-06-18 15:41本頁(yè)面
  

【正文】 II Abstract The hardware structure of data collection system based on SCM is primarily presented in the its software is designed secondly. Take the AT89C52 SCM and a/d conversion chip ADC0809 as a core, this system has two parts: A/D transforms, data processing and demonstration. Specifically includes the control, the demonstration, the A/D switch and so on. In the design carries on 8ways with ADC0809 according to the sampling, uses the AT89C52 SCM the serial mouth transmission and thereceive data. Demonstrated partially constitutes by the LED numericalcode monitor. The hardware design application electron design automation tool, the software design uses the modular programmingmethod. Key Words: AT89C52, SCM, A/d conversion, ADC0809, LED numerical code tube 8路輸入模擬信號(hào)數(shù)值顯示器的設(shè)計(jì) 1 1 引言 隨著計(jì)算機(jī)技術(shù)的飛速發(fā)展及普及, 多路輸入模擬信號(hào)數(shù)值顯示 系統(tǒng)在多個(gè)領(lǐng)域有著廣泛的應(yīng)用。顯示部分由 LED數(shù)碼顯示器構(gòu)成。具體包括控制、顯示、 A/D轉(zhuǎn)換器等。8路輸入模擬信號(hào)數(shù)值顯示器的設(shè)計(jì) 西 安 郵 電 學(xué) 院 畢 業(yè) 設(shè) 計(jì)(論 文) 題 目: 8 路輸入模擬信號(hào)數(shù)值顯示器的設(shè)計(jì) 系 別: 專(zhuān) 業(yè): 班 級(jí): 學(xué)生姓名: 導(dǎo)師姓名: 職 稱(chēng): 起止時(shí)間: 2021 年 3 月 19 日 至 2021 年 6 月 24 日 8路輸入模擬信號(hào)數(shù)值顯示器的設(shè)計(jì) 目 錄 摘 要 ............................................................ I Abstract............................................................ II 1 引言 ............................................................. 1 2 系統(tǒng)概述 ........................................................ 1 硬件電路簡(jiǎn)介 ................................................... 1 軟件設(shè)計(jì)簡(jiǎn)介 ................................................... 2 3 系統(tǒng)方案的選擇和論證 .......................................... 3 系統(tǒng)設(shè)計(jì)方案的選擇 ............................................. 3 各模塊方案選擇和論證 ........................................... 3 系統(tǒng)各個(gè)模塊的最終方案 ........................................ 11 4 系統(tǒng)的硬件設(shè)計(jì) ................................................ 11 硬件電路各模塊簡(jiǎn)介 ............................................ 11 系統(tǒng)的仿真 .................................................... 21 5 系統(tǒng)的軟件設(shè)計(jì) ................................................ 21 主程序的設(shè)計(jì) .................................................. 22 各子程序的設(shè)計(jì) ................................................ 22 8路輸入模擬信號(hào)數(shù)值顯示器的設(shè)計(jì) 6 系統(tǒng)調(diào)試 ....................................................... 25 調(diào)試過(guò)程中出現(xiàn)的問(wèn)題 .......................................... 25 問(wèn)題分析與解決 ................................................ 25 7 結(jié) 論 ........................................................... 26 致 謝 ........................................................... 27 參考文獻(xiàn) ......................................................... 28 附錄 .............................................................. 29 8路輸入模擬信號(hào)數(shù)值顯示器的設(shè)計(jì) I 摘 要 本文主要論述 了基于單片機(jī)的 A/D轉(zhuǎn)換 的硬件結(jié)構(gòu) ,并在此基礎(chǔ)上進(jìn)行了軟件設(shè)計(jì)。 以 AT89C52 單片機(jī) 及模數(shù)轉(zhuǎn)換芯片 ADC0809為核心,該系統(tǒng) 有 兩 個(gè)部分: A/D轉(zhuǎn)換 ,數(shù)據(jù)處理和顯示。設(shè)計(jì)中用 ADC0809進(jìn)行 8路數(shù)據(jù)的采樣,利用 AT89C52單片機(jī)的串行口發(fā)送和接收數(shù)據(jù)。硬件設(shè)計(jì)應(yīng)用電子設(shè)計(jì)自動(dòng)化工具 ,軟件設(shè)計(jì)采用模塊化編程方法。 多路 輸入模擬信號(hào)數(shù)值顯示 是工、農(nóng)業(yè)控制系統(tǒng)中至關(guān)重要的一環(huán),在醫(yī)藥、化工、食品、等領(lǐng)域的生產(chǎn)過(guò)程中,往往需要隨時(shí)檢測(cè)各生產(chǎn)環(huán)節(jié)的溫度、濕度、流量及壓力等參數(shù) 。 隨著工、農(nóng)業(yè)的發(fā)展,多路 輸入模擬信號(hào)數(shù)值顯示 勢(shì)必將得到越來(lái)越 廣泛 的應(yīng)用,為適應(yīng)這一趨勢(shì),作這方面的研究就顯得十分重要??傊?,不論在哪個(gè)應(yīng)用領(lǐng)域中,數(shù)據(jù)采集與處理將直接影響工作效率和所取得的經(jīng)濟(jì)效益。 把由電壓表輸出的 0~5V的模擬電壓信號(hào)送給模數(shù)轉(zhuǎn)換器,然后 A/D 轉(zhuǎn)換器將該模擬信號(hào)轉(zhuǎn)換為 00H~FFH 的數(shù)字信號(hào),當(dāng)轉(zhuǎn)換結(jié)束時(shí)發(fā)送轉(zhuǎn)換結(jié)束信號(hào)給單片機(jī) AT89C52,單片機(jī)對(duì)其轉(zhuǎn)換后的結(jié)果進(jìn)行處理,處理后的結(jié)果送往 LED 數(shù)碼管進(jìn)行顯示。 8 路輸入模擬信號(hào)數(shù)值顯示系統(tǒng) 可以分為兩大模塊: ? 硬件 電路 模塊 ? 軟件設(shè)計(jì) 模塊 硬件電路簡(jiǎn)介 根據(jù)系統(tǒng)的設(shè)計(jì)要求,可以將系統(tǒng)硬件電路 模塊 劃分為以下 三 個(gè)部分 : 8路輸入模擬信號(hào)數(shù)值顯示器的設(shè)計(jì) 2 ? 主控制器模塊 ? 數(shù)據(jù)采集 模塊 ? 顯示 模塊 主控制器模塊 主控制器模塊是 8 路輸入模擬信號(hào)數(shù)值顯示器的核心控制部分,該模 塊 主要 由單片機(jī)構(gòu)成,通過(guò)單片機(jī)的各個(gè) I/O 口對(duì)外圍設(shè)備的控制,以達(dá)到 A/D 轉(zhuǎn)換,顯示數(shù)據(jù)等功能。雖然這些模擬量已經(jīng)由傳感器、變送器變換成標(biāo)準(zhǔn)的電壓或電流信號(hào),但還需要通過(guò) A/D 轉(zhuǎn)換器,將其轉(zhuǎn)換成計(jì)算機(jī)能處理的相應(yīng)的數(shù)字信號(hào)。 在本論文中, 數(shù)據(jù)采集模塊 主要 是 模數(shù)轉(zhuǎn)換器 ADC0809。并且通過(guò) START 引腳啟動(dòng)轉(zhuǎn)換 ,將轉(zhuǎn)換得到的數(shù)字信號(hào)利用 8 位數(shù)據(jù)輸出線傳輸給單片機(jī)的 P0 口。 LED 顯示器由若干個(gè)發(fā)光二極管組成,當(dāng)發(fā)光二極管導(dǎo)通時(shí),相應(yīng)的一個(gè)筆畫(huà)或一個(gè)點(diǎn)就發(fā)光。 本論文中, 顯示模塊主要有七段共陽(yáng)極 LED 數(shù)碼管 構(gòu)成, 顯示電路采用的是動(dòng)態(tài)顯示接口電路。 軟件設(shè)計(jì)簡(jiǎn)介 該系統(tǒng)的軟件設(shè)計(jì)也可以相應(yīng)的分為以下兩部分: ? A/D 轉(zhuǎn)換程 序設(shè)計(jì) ? 顯示程序設(shè)計(jì) A/D 轉(zhuǎn)換程序設(shè)計(jì) A/D 轉(zhuǎn)換程序的設(shè)計(jì)是該系統(tǒng)實(shí)現(xiàn)的核心部分,通過(guò)設(shè)計(jì) A/D 轉(zhuǎn)換程序驅(qū)動(dòng)單片機(jī)向模數(shù)轉(zhuǎn)換器 ADC0809 輸入指令開(kāi)啟模數(shù)轉(zhuǎn)換,以達(dá)到系統(tǒng)設(shè)計(jì)的主要功能。這部分程序也主要是對(duì)單片機(jī)進(jìn)行編程來(lái)驅(qū)動(dòng) LED 數(shù)碼管進(jìn)行正常的顯示工作。本顯示器可自動(dòng)輪流顯示 8 路輸入模擬信號(hào)的數(shù)值,最小分辨率為,最大顯示數(shù)值為 255(輸入為 5V時(shí)),模擬輸入最大值為 5V,可作為數(shù)字電壓表用。 其中系統(tǒng)的 主控制器 采用 AT89C52 單片機(jī) ,直接 驅(qū)動(dòng) LED 數(shù)碼管, 數(shù)據(jù)采集模塊 由 AT89C52 與 ADC0809 組成 。 系統(tǒng)框圖如圖 31 所示 M C UA D C L E D8 路 輸 入模 擬 信 號(hào) 圖 31 系統(tǒng)模塊框圖 主控制器 模塊 的 分析與 選擇 用單片機(jī)作為這一控制系統(tǒng)的核心,接 收 來(lái)自 ADC0809 的數(shù)據(jù),經(jīng)處理后通 8路輸入模擬信號(hào)數(shù)值顯示器的設(shè)計(jì) 4 過(guò)串口傳送,由于系統(tǒng)功能簡(jiǎn)單,單片機(jī)通過(guò)與 LED 數(shù)碼顯示器相連,驅(qū)動(dòng)顯示器顯示相應(yīng)通道采集到的數(shù)據(jù)。 時(shí)鐘電路 的選擇 : AT89C52 中有一個(gè)用于構(gòu)成內(nèi)部振蕩器的高增益反相放大器 ,引腳 XTAL1 和XTAL2 分別是該放大器的輸入端和輸出端 。 方案一:內(nèi)部 時(shí)鐘方式 ,如圖 31 圖 31 內(nèi)部時(shí)鐘方式 外接石英 晶 體 (或陶瓷諧振器 )及電容 C1, C2 接 在放大器的反饋回路中構(gòu)成并聯(lián)振蕩電路。 方案二:外部 時(shí)鐘方式,如圖 32 8路輸入模擬信號(hào)數(shù)值顯示器的設(shè)計(jì) 5 圖 32 外部 時(shí)鐘方式 外部振蕩器信號(hào)的接法與芯片類(lèi)型有關(guān)。 HMOS 工藝的 MCU 則 XTAL2 端接外部時(shí)鐘信號(hào), XTAL1 端須 接地。所以時(shí)鐘電路采取內(nèi)部時(shí)鐘方式。 a 轉(zhuǎn)換原理的選擇 隨著大規(guī)模集成電路技術(shù)的迅速發(fā)展, A/D 轉(zhuǎn)換器新品不斷推出。 方案一:逐次逼近式 ADC 的轉(zhuǎn)換原理 8路輸入模擬信號(hào)數(shù)值顯示器的設(shè)計(jì) 6 圖 33 是逐次逼近式 ADC 的工作原理圖。 圖 33 逐次逼近式 ADC 原理圖 在時(shí)鐘脈沖的同步下,控制邏輯先使 N 位寄存器的 D7 位置 1(其余位為 0)。于是在時(shí)鐘脈沖的同步下,保留 D7=1,并使下一位 D6=1,所得新值( C0H)再經(jīng) DAC 轉(zhuǎn)換得到新的 VN,再與 VIN比較,重復(fù)前述過(guò)程。以此類(lèi)推,從 D7 到 D0 都比較完畢,轉(zhuǎn)換便結(jié)束。 方案二:雙積分式 ADC 的轉(zhuǎn)換原理 圖 34 是雙積分式 A/D 轉(zhuǎn)換器 ??刂七壿嬒葘?duì)未知的輸入模擬電壓 VIN進(jìn)行固定時(shí)間 T 的積分,然后轉(zhuǎn)為對(duì)標(biāo)準(zhǔn)電壓進(jìn)行反向積分,直至積分輸出返回起始值。輸入電壓大,則反向積分時(shí)間長(zhǎng)。 圖 35 雙積分式 ADC 工作原理 b 轉(zhuǎn)換時(shí)間的選擇 轉(zhuǎn)換速度是指完成一次 A/D 轉(zhuǎn)換所需時(shí)間的倒數(shù),是一個(gè)很重要的指標(biāo)。通常, 8 位逐次比較式 ADC 的轉(zhuǎn)換時(shí)間為100us 左右。 8路輸入模擬信號(hào)數(shù)值顯示器的設(shè)計(jì) 8 c ADC 位數(shù)的選擇 A/D 轉(zhuǎn)換器的位數(shù)決定著信號(hào)采集的精度和分辨率。 用它可直接將 8 個(gè)單端模擬信號(hào)輸入,分時(shí)進(jìn)行 A/D 轉(zhuǎn)換,在多點(diǎn)巡回監(jiān)測(cè)、過(guò)程控制等領(lǐng)域中使用非常廣泛 , 所以本設(shè)計(jì)中選用該芯片作為 A/D 轉(zhuǎn)換電路的核心。 方案一:經(jīng)典接口方式。
點(diǎn)擊復(fù)制文檔內(nèi)容
畢業(yè)設(shè)計(jì)相關(guān)推薦